SVPE and VOICES Peer Educator Request Form
The Office for Sexual Violence Prevention and Education (SVPE) believes that education is a powerful tool in the prevention and response to gender-based violence. This form is intended for individuals, student organizations, faculty, and staff seeking tailored educational sessions or workshops on topics related to gender-based violence, including healthy relationships, conflict management, and bystander intervention.
